Transaction 7a60b8ed1c4a50913149e3a392cf8865bf24fa866585a7f64bb79f7806a59fbf
1 Input
1 Output
-
7a60b8ed1c4a50913149e3a392cf8865bf24fa866585a7f64bb79f7806a59fbf:0
- value
- 686691005
- script pubkey
- OP_0 OP_PUSHBYTES_20 de7b2a576fe405451a26823f29ad887a2f980f22
- address
- bc1qmeaj54m0usz52x3xsgljntvg0ghesrezrw6z8q